> > We are running a mixture of Windows and Linux VMs under different
> accounts
> > on our cloud, that is based on CloudPlatform 3 (I know that it's a
> mailing
> > list for ACS, but I still need your feedback so read on please :)).
> >
> > The Primary storage is based on iSCSI with GigE link, and Xen hyperviser.
> >
> > Now the problem is that whenever we run Windows OSes with applications
> like
> > Exchange, Sharepoint and particularly MS Lync (that includes AD and MSSQL
> > as pre-requisites..), the GigE link to Primary Storage becomes so
> congested
> > that it affects the whole cloud environment. Nothing remains usable
> > anymore, the performance of Linux VMs also is affected in the process.
> >
> > So what does your experience say, what should we do:
> > 1)  Segregate the Windows VMs to their own cluster and their own separate
> > Primary storage.
> > 2) Use local storage for the "pre-cloud era" traditional Windows
> workloads
> > such as MS Exchange etc.
> > 3)  Is cloud environment feasible at all for Hosted Exchange and the
> like,
> > as Local storage that runs on the speed of the motherboard back-plane, of
> > course cannot be matched by a GigE link alone.
